About Légerville, New Brunswick

Légerville is a locality in Kent, New Brunswick,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Légerville is located at 46.3073°N, 65.0017°W. It observes Atlantic Time (UTC−4 / −3). Postal code area: E4T.

Légerville sits quietly upon the land, defined by the steady presence of the Fisher Hill and the persistent, low-lying moisture that defines the local terrain. It lies 18.0 km west-north-west of Maple Hills, NB (from Maple Hills, NB: bearing 301°T), and is situated 2.9 km south of Saint-Paul.
